A new approach to vector-valued rational interpolation

In this work we propose three different procedures for vector-valued rational interpolation of a function F(z), where F : C → C , and develop algorithms for constructing the resulting rational functions. We show that these procedures also cover the general case in which some or all points of interpolation coalesce. In particular, we show that, when all the points of interpolation collapse to th...

Vector Fitting for Matrix-valued Rational Approximation

Vector Fitting (VF) is a popular method of constructing rational approximants that provides a least squares fit to frequency response measurements. In an earlier work, we provided an analysis of VF for scalar-valued rational functions and established a connection with optimal H 2 approximation. We build on this work and extend the previous framework to include the construction of effective rati...
